Philip Gardiner
Philip Gardiner, a British director born in 1969 in Nottinghamshire, England, has been actively making films since the early 2000s. Predominantly focusing on the horror and documentary genres, Gardiner is best known for his films like "Paranormal Haunting: The Curse of the Blue Moon Inn" and "The Stone: No Soul Unturned," although he hasn't been recognized with awards at major film festivals. His directorial style often incorporates elements of mysticism and the supernatural, creating a unique blend of reality and the unknown in his works. A lover of the eerie and unexplained, Philip Gardiner's films are a testament to his fascination with the darker side of the human psyche and the mysteries of the unknown world.
